What to expect

Distilled from the reports

Application & Communication

Candidates often experience a lack of communication during the application stage, with some not receiving interviews despite meeting qualifications. Transparency in scheduling and follow-ups is frequently noted as an area for improvement.

Recruiter & HR Screening

The initial recruiter or HR screening typically focuses on background, motivation, and fit for the role, often using a friendly and conversational tone. Candidates should prepare concise behavioral examples, as these are commonly emphasized.

Technical Interviews

Technical interviews vary in depth but often include discussions on role-relevant knowledge and process-focused questions, particularly for roles that intersect with operational disciplines. Candidates should be ready to demonstrate both technical skills and their application in real-world contexts.

Behavioral & Cultural Fit

Behavioral interviews are a significant component of the process, with many candidates reporting a focus on cultural fit and teamwork experiences. Success in these interviews often hinges on clearly articulating past group work and situational responses.

Interview Structure & Flow

The interview process can involve multiple rounds, often alternating between HR and technical discussions, which may lead to a longer evaluation period. Candidates should expect a structured flow with various stakeholders involved.

Outcome & Feedback

Candidates frequently report delays in receiving feedback or outcomes after interviews, which can lead to frustration. It is advisable to follow up for clarity on decisions and timelines.
